29 BURNS STREET is a very small extended semi-detached house of 71m², built sometime between 1950 and 1966. It was last sold for £115,000 in December 2021, which was around 42% below the average December 2021 detached price in the County Durham local authority area. The most recent EPC inspection was June 2017, where the current energy rating was D, and the potential energy rating was B.

29 BURNS STREET Price Paid vs. HPI Average

The below graph shows the average detached house price in the County Durham local authority area over time, sourced from the HPI. The two 29 BURNS STREET sales from August 2017 and December 2021 have been plotted on the graph. A line has been extrapolated to show what the value of the property might have been over time, following each sale, had it maintained the same margin above or below the HPI (as a percentage). For example, the August 2017 sale was for 63% below the HPI. So the extrapolation line tracks at 63% below the HPI over time, until the December 2021 sale, where it rises to 42% below the HPI. The line then continues to track at 42% below the HPI.
